autohotkey 循环
时间: 2023-10-23 15:30:13 浏览: 232
在AutoHotkey中,循环可以通过使用loop命令或while命令来实现。引用中给出了使用loop命令的示例代码,其中循环会一直执行,直到用户释放了F1键。在循环内部,首先检查F1键是否被释放,如果是,则中断循环;否则,继续执行点击鼠标的操作。最后,通过return语句来结束函数。
另一种循环方法是使用while命令,在循环条件中使用GetKeyState函数来判断F1键是否被按住。只要F1键被按住,循环就会继续执行点击鼠标的操作。当F1键被释放时,循环停止执行,并通过return语句结束函数。需要注意的是,这里的while循环是一个无限循环,只有在循环内部的条件判断中才会决定是否继续执行。
所以,autohotkey中的循环可以使用loop命令或while命令来实现,具体使用哪种方式取决于需求和代码的逻辑。<span class="em">1</span><span class="em">2</span>
#### 引用[.reference_title]
- *1* [autohotkey循环](https://blog.csdn.net/qq_38619183/article/details/83211041)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[AutoHotkey如何循环读取ini文件里所有section的所有key值](https://blog.csdn.net/wbryfl/article/details/51442552)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文